Documents for @litert/idempotency / Serializers/JsonSerializer / JsonSerializer
Class: JsonSerializer
Defined in: src/lib/Serializers/JsonSerializer.ts:23
The serializer for successful results, using JSON.stringify
and JSON.parse
.
Implements
ISerializer
<any
>
Constructors
Constructor
new JsonSerializer():
JsonSerializer
Returns
JsonSerializer
Methods
deserialize()
deserialize(
data
):any
Defined in: src/lib/Serializers/JsonSerializer.ts:36
Deserialize data back to the original type.
Parameters
data
The serialized data to deserialize.
string
| Buffer
<ArrayBufferLike
>
Returns
any
Implementation of
serialize()
serialize(
data
):string
Defined in: src/lib/Serializers/JsonSerializer.ts:25
Serialize data to a string or Buffer.
Parameters
data
unknown
The data to serialize.
Returns
string